NATCA Makes Plea To FAA For More Bargaining
The National Air Traffic Controllers Association on Friday made its second request in a week to the FAA to return to the bargaining table, saying it is not too late to reach a voluntary agreement. "I am convinced beyond any doubt that a voluntary agreement which can be ratified by the covered...
